Move Beyond Cancer
What is it?
Move Beyond Cancer is a community programme supporting Somali, Iranian, and Eastern European communities in North Central London who are living with or have been impacted by cancer. The programme offers gentle, tailored physical activity sessions, walk-and-talk groups, and peer support to help participants stay active, build confidence, and feel connected. The initiative is delivered in partnership between CB Plus, Better by GLL, Centre of Excellence, Romanian Culture and Charity Together, and Yaran Women’s Club.
How can it help me?
Move Beyond Cancer aims to:
-
Provide a safe, supportive space to meet others affected by cancer
-
Encourage physical activity and wellbeing through exercise sessions and walk-and-talk groups
-
Reduce social isolation and improve mental health
-
Share guidance and information about staying active during and after treatment
How do I access it?
Before attending activity sessions, participants are asked to complete a Pre-Session Health Questionnaire to ensure sessions are safe and suitable for individual needs. All information is treated confidentially.
